BIDDEFORD (AP) — The Maine fire marshal’s office says one man is grave condition and other critical after an apartment fire in Biddeford believed to be arson.

Six other people were treated at the hospital and released following the Biddeford fire Thursday morning.

Hospitalized in grave condition at Maine Medical Center is 23-year-old Michael Moore; 21-year-old James Ford is in critical condition. Both were rescued from their third-floor apartment by firefighters.

The fire marshal’s office says the fire was set in the rear stairwell of the building.

The state police are helping with the investigation.
